A Study on a Relationship Between University Students Life Stress and Suicidal Ideation: Mediating Effect of Mental Health

Abstract
This study was intended to investigate the effect of life stress of university students on the suicidal ideation and to verify the mediating effect of personal mental health on a relationship between life stress and suicidal ideation. Therefore, this study collected data from 491 university students who are enrolled in 4 universities located in Daejeon Metropolitan City, Chungnam, and Chungbuk. According to the main findings of this research, life stress, suicidal ideation, and mental health had statistically significant correlation. Secondly, life stress not only makes direct effect on the suicidal ideation, but makes indirect effect through a mediating variable, the mental health, as well that mental health is verified to mediate a relationship between life stress and suicidal ideation. The research results suggest that mental health of university students is impoverished when life stress is higher, and can make effect on the suicidal ideation due to continual phenomenon of losing general function of life. This study investigated how counselors can intervene convergence policy approach with mental health of clients that affects the relationship between life stress and suicidal ideation of university students, and suggested implication and limitation of this study and suggestions for a follow-up study.
